The verdict
SE Ranking — 80/100
SE Ranking wins by 17 points on stronger earnings structure, a longer attribution window (120 days vs 30 days), lower payout friction. Mangools still makes sense for a specific fit: beginner-SEO and budget-tool content.
Verified terms, side by side
| Field | SE Ranking | Mangools |
|---|---|---|
| Commission | 30% recurring, lifetime | 30% recurring, lifetime |
| Model | Recurring (lifetime) | Recurring (lifetime) |
| Cookie duration | 120 days ✓ | 30 days |
| Est. $/first referral | ~$100 ✓ | ~$12 |
| Network | In-house | In-house |
| Payout threshold | $50 | $150 |
| Payout methods | PayPal, wire | PayPal, wire |
| Payment terms | Twice monthly | Monthly, ~NET 25 |
| Geo focus | Global | Global |
| Terms verified | 2026-08 | 2026-08 |
